About the Stud Station

The stud and service station address horse owners who want to cover their mare. Both stallions stationed at Lövsta Stuteri and stallions from other parts of Sweden and Europe are used to gain access to the entire international market.

The farm has a complete breeding facility with thoughtful solutions for both stallions, mares and foals. The facility accommodates stables, pastures, horse walker, an indoor arena and a gallop track in wonderful surroundings. The breeding centre, beautifully situated in a fantastic environment for both people and horses, take customized service to the next level.

Lövsta Stuteri offers a wide range of internationally sought-after stallions. The stallions are carefully selected based on a combination of performance, temperament and rideability.

By choosing one of Lövsta Stuteri's stallions, you are assured that the stallion has passed the tests for all the criteria considered important for sustainable success. Continuous evaluation of sustainability, performance level and development as a competition horse is an important part of the stallion selection. Good fertility is another important parameter in the choice of stallion and directly determinative of the result. A stallion from Lövsta Stuteri's stallion program is one stallion in top-class.

In 2020, Lövsta opened a branch, Borebackar Gård in Torna-Hällestad, to get closer to our customers in the south. At Borebackar, showjumping horses are trained and through the collaboration with Lövsta Stuteri also showjumping stallions. The farm is managed by Alexandra Mörner and her husband Niko Röhlcke. Stable manager is Rebecca Milton, who has worked with Lövsta's show jumping stallions for several years. The training takes place in close collaboration with Lövsta's breeding advisor, Jens Fredricson, who is an important person for Lövsta's breeding activities. Read more about Borebackar here.
